.branded-contact__logo{margin:0 40px 0 0;width:120px}@media(min-width:1024px)and (max-width:1279px){.branded-contact__logo{margin:0 10px 0 0;width:100px}}@media(min-width:1280px){.branded-contact__logo{width:130px}}@media(min-width:1536px){.branded-contact__logo{width:150px}}.branded-contact__intro-block{margin-top:36px}@media(min-width:768px){.branded-contact__intro-block{margin-top:0}}.branded-contact__contact{margin-left:-40px}.branded-contact__form{background-color:#d9d9d9;padding:20px}@media(min-width:1280px){.branded-contact__form{padding:40px}}.branded-contact__form-red{background-color:#ea131b;color:#fff!important}.branded-contact__form-red .branded-contact--right__title,.branded-contact__form-red .gfield_required,.branded-contact__form-red .gform_title,.branded-contact__form-red .pre-title{color:#fff!important}.branded-contact__form-red input{color:#333!important}.branded-contact__form-red .mktoFormCol .mktoHtmlText{color:#fff!important}.branded-contact__form-red .mktoFormCol .mktoHtmlText a{color:#fff!important;text-decoration:underline!important}.branded-contact__form-red .mktoButtonRow .mktoButton{background-color:#333!important;color:#fff!important}.branded-contact__form-red .branded-contact__cta:hover,.branded-contact__form-red .mktoButtonRow .mktoButton:hover{background-color:#fff!important;color:#333!important}.branded-contact__form-red .gform-field-label a{color:#fff!important}.branded-contact__form-red .gform_footer input[type=button],.branded-contact__form-red .gform_footer input[type=submit]{background-color:#333!important;color:#fff!important}.branded-contact__form-red .gform_footer input[type=button]:hover,.branded-contact__form-red .gform_footer input[type=submit]:hover{background-color:#fff!important;color:#333!important}.branded-contact--right{position:relative;z-index:5}.branded-contact--right__title{margin-bottom:20px}.branded-contact__content ul{list-style-image:url(/app/themes/acora-theme/public/images/bullet-arrow-red-thicker.0098ac.svg)}.branded-contact__content .branded-contact--left h1,.branded-contact__content .branded-contact--left h2,.branded-contact__content .branded-contact--left h3,.branded-contact__content .branded-contact--left h4,.branded-contact__content .branded-contact--right h1,.branded-contact__content .branded-contact--right h2,.branded-contact__content .branded-contact--right h3,.branded-contact__content .branded-contact--right h4{font-size:1.8rem;line-height:1.2}@media(min-width:1536px){.branded-contact__content .branded-contact--left h1,.branded-contact__content .branded-contact--left h2,.branded-contact__content .branded-contact--left h3,.branded-contact__content .branded-contact--left h4,.branded-contact__content .branded-contact--right h1,.branded-contact__content .branded-contact--right h2,.branded-contact__content .branded-contact--right h3,.branded-contact__content .branded-contact--right h4{font-size:2.5rem}}.branded-contact__content .mktoRequiredField label .mktoAsterix{display:none}.branded-contact__content.branded-contact--reorder .branded-contact--right{order:1}.branded-contact__content.branded-contact--reorder .branded-contact--left{order:2}@media(min-width:1024px){.branded-contact__content.branded-contact--reorder .branded-contact--left .branded-contact__intro-block{padding-left:30px}}@media(min-width:1280px){.branded-contact__content.branded-contact--reorder .branded-contact--left .branded-contact__intro-block{padding-left:60px}}@media(max-width:1023px){.branded-contact__content.branded-contact--reorder .branded-contact--left .branded-contact__intro-block{margin-top:40px}}.branded-contact__content.branded-contact--reorder h2{font-size:28px}@media(min-width:1024px){.branded-contact__content.branded-contact--reorder h2{font-size:32px}}@media(min-width:1280px){.branded-contact__content.branded-contact--reorder h2{font-size:40px}}.branded-contact__content.branded-contact--reorder h3,.branded-contact__content.branded-contact--reorder h4{font-size:20px;font-weight:700;margin-bottom:16px;margin-top:24px}@media(min-width:1024px){.branded-contact__content.branded-contact--reorder h3,.branded-contact__content.branded-contact--reorder h4{font-size:24px;margin-top:32px}}.branded-contact__content.branded-contact--reorder a:not(.btn){color:#ea131b;text-decoration:underline;transition:all .25s linear}.branded-contact__content.branded-contact--reorder a:not(.btn):hover{color:#333}.branded-contact__content.branded-contact--reorder .intro-block__cta{margin-top:30px}@media(min-width:1024px){.branded-contact__content.branded-contact--reorder .intro-block__cta{margin-top:40px}}.branded-contact__cta{margin:20px 0}.branded-contact .gform_wrapper.gravity-theme .gfield input[type=email]{width:100%}.branded-contact .gform_wrapper.gravity-theme .gfield select{color:#575756}.branded-contact .gform_wrapper.gravity-theme .gform_description,.branded-contact .gform_wrapper.gravity-theme .gform_title{margin-bottom:20px}.branded-contact .gform_wrapper.gravity-theme .pre-title{margin-bottom:.4em}